4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E is a very large extended detached house of 224m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929, which could now be worth an estimated £920,361. It was last sold for £870,000 in August 2024, which was around 122% above the average August 2024 detached price in the Coventry local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2023, where the current energy rating was E, and the potential energy rating was C.

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Coventry local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E sales from January 2017 and August 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2017 sale was for 132%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 132% above the HPI over time, until the August 2024 sale, where it falls to 122%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 122% above the HPI.

What might 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E be worth now?

4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£920,361.

This is based on house price inflation of 5.8%, between August 2024 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Coventry local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 5.8%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E of £870,000 on 9th August 2024. For the value to have increased from £870,000 to £920,361 over the one year and six months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Coventry local authority area.
  • The August 2024 sale price of £870,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E has not materially changed since August 2024.

4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E sits on a plot of roughly 0.235 of an acre, or 952m². The below map shows the location of 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 4 SOUTHLEIGH AVENUE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
